BAGHDAD, Oct. 19 (Xinhua) -- UN special representative to Iraq Ad Melkert's convoy was hit by a roadside bomb in south of Baghdad on Tuesday, but he was not hurt, local police said.
The convoy was on its way back to Baghdad from Iraq's southern city of Najaf where Melkert met with Shitte cleric Ali al-Sistani, the unnamed police source said.
The attack killed one Iraqi policeman and wounded four others, he added.
